Official statement

The Club will apply a 25% discount on next year’s season ticket and a 50% discount on the price of the current kits to season ticket holders who have attended the last seven home games. You don’t need to be present during the upcoming match against UD Ibiza to take advantage of the discount.

Málaga CF will face UD Ibiza in a match with little impact on the standings. The Club announced an offer to season ticket holders on 14th February to guarantee the best possible atmosphere at La Rosaleda and support the team while there were options to stay up. However, now relegation is confirmed, season ticket holders don’t need to attend this match in order to enjoy the aforementioned promotion.

The promotion in question stated that all season ticket holders who attended the last eight LaLiga SmartBank matches would enjoy a 25% discount on next year's season ticket and 50% off the purchase price of the 22/23 official jerseys.

However, given that Saturday's match (18:30 at La Rosaleda) will no longer have a great sporting impact, Málaga CF will apply this discount to all season ticket holders who have already attended the last seven matches of the season at home (against Real Zaragoza, Real Racing Club, Levante UD, CD Leganés, FC Cartagena, SD Huesca and CD Mirandés).

The Club considers that the fans have more than fulfilled their part of the agreement and, therefore, it would be unfair not to apply the discount to season ticket holders who have carried their team forward in such complex and important moments.

Thank you, Málaga is you.
